NAME
dasum - Return the sum of the absolute values of a vector x.
SYNOPSIS
DOUBLE PRECISION DASUM (N, X, INCX)
INTEGER INCX, N
DOUBLE PRECISION X( ∗ )
#include <sunperf.h>
double dasum(int n, double ∗dx, int incx) ;
PURPOSE
DASUM - Return the sum of the absolute values of x where x is an n-vector.
PARAMETERS
N - INTEGER.
On entry, N specifies the number of elements in the vector. N must be at least one for the subroutine to have any visible effect. Unchanged on exit.
X - DOUBLE PRECISION array of DIMENSION at least
( 1 + ( m - 1 )∗abs( INCY ) ). On entry, the incremented array X must contain the vector x. On exit, X is overwritten by the updated vector x.
INCX - INTEGER.
On entry, INCX specifies the increment for the elements of X. INCX must not be zero. Unchanged on exit.
